To ask the Minister for Education and Skills if consideration has been given to her Department recruiting on a permanent basis architects, engineers, and quantity surveyors in order to provide in-house design team support for school capital projects; if any analysis has been carried out on the potential savings of such an approach;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[12945/24]
Norma Foley (Kerry,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source
There are currently 42 professional and technical staff employed in the Planning and Building Unit of my Department. The grades working in this unit consist of Senior Quantity Surveyors, Senior Building Service Engineers, Senior Civil and Structural Engineers, Senior Architects, Architects, Architectural Assistants and Senior Technical Officers who are led by Technical Managers. In 2023, the Department ran three open competitions for the grades of Senior Quantity Surveyor, Senior Building Services Engineer and Architect. In 2024, it is planned that the Department will run additional professional and technical competitions via the Public Appointments Service in order to strengthen and enhance the existing capacity of the Planning and Building Unit in response to the growing demand of services required to support the Department’s School Building Programme under its National Development Plan commitments.
